QuadRF has announced a new detection system capable of identifying drones and viewing WiFi signals through walls, confirmed by the company. This development could significantly impact security and privacy, as it enables surveillance beyond traditional line-of-sight limitations.
According to QuadRF, their technology uses advanced radio frequency (RF) sensing to detect the presence of drones in a specified area, even if they are concealed behind obstacles. Additionally, the system can analyze WiFi signals passing through walls, allowing users to see network activity and potentially gather information from within buildings. The company states that these capabilities are enabled by proprietary RF signal processing algorithms that can distinguish specific RF signatures.
While QuadRF claims their system can reliably detect drones and WiFi signals through walls, independent verification and testing are still pending. Experts note that RF sensing of this kind has been in development for some time, but the claimed dual functionality is notable for its potential applications in security and surveillance. The company has not yet disclosed detailed technical specifications or operational limits.
Implications for Security and Privacy
This technology could transform security practices by allowing authorities or malicious actors to detect drones in restricted areas without visual contact. It also raises privacy concerns, as WiFi signals could be monitored inside private spaces without physical access. The ability to see through walls challenges existing notions of physical and digital privacy, prompting discussions about regulation and oversight.

Background on RF Sensing and Surveillance Tech
RF sensing technology has been evolving over recent years, with applications ranging from military to civilian security. Previous systems could detect the presence of RF-emitting devices or analyze signals for location and activity. However, the combination of drone detection and WiFi visualization through walls, as claimed by QuadRF, represents a notable advancement. Similar capabilities have been explored in research settings, but commercial deployment at this scale remains limited.
QuadRF’s announcement follows a broader trend of developing covert surveillance tools, raising questions about the balance between security needs and individual rights. Experts caution that such technology could be misused if not properly regulated.
